Output 960625da496393530ec08a0c58d64b1f6836e5a72239f692f6122089a250dfe3:4

value
12960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4896d43d1b4eb2854a021bd691cf575aa99db665 OP_EQUAL
address
38JqG9CXvk2GaM1ybgHh1gfreFqSbKYWeA
transaction
960625da496393530ec08a0c58d64b1f6836e5a72239f692f6122089a250dfe3
confirmations
307511
spent
true